Description
People working on the context menu of JupyterLab have run into various problems (see jupyterlab/jupyterlab#4529 for a good overview). After spending a while thinking about it, I believe that all of the issues can be resolved by making the contextmenu items in @phorsphor/widgets a little bit smarter/more aware of the circumstances under which they were invoked. Specifically, I think that two changes are required:
-
There needs to be a way to pass information contained in the target of a contextmenu event (ie the node that the user actually right-clicked) on to the command of a contextmenu item.
-
There needs to be a way to decide whether to hide/show a contextmenu item based on the result of a callback that takes the contextmenu event target as an argument. This would be in addition to (or possibly instead of) the existing selector property.
